The question

How will the deaf and mute be judged, and is he obligated to attend Friday prayer?

The answer

A person's accountability is solely tied to their intellect. If they are an adult and of sound mind, they are accountable and will be held responsible for their actions, even if they are deaf and cannot hear or speak. They are excused regarding matters of the Shari'ah that did not reach them. However, they will be held accountable for what did reach them and what they understood. The evidence for their accountability is what the jurists mentioned regarding the obligation of Friday prayer upon them, as long as the preacher is not mute. The Hadith also indicates that the deaf, the imbecile, and those who died during an interim period will be tested on the Day of Judgment.
